Map
Index
Random
Help
th

Quote: programmers can identify synchronization and data operations in performance-critical areas for weak order optimization; example of programmer-centric approach to relaxed memory consistency

topics > all references > references a-b > QuoteRef: adveSV12_1996 , p. 74



Topic:
optimistic update for concurrency control
Topic:
race conditions
Topic:
code optimization by advice and statistics
Topic:
man-machine symbiosis

Quotation Skeleton

To illustrate the programmer-centric approach [to relaxed memory consistency], we describe … [Weak Order]-like optimizations. Recall that weak ordering is based on the intuition … be executed more aggressively than synchronization operations. … An operation is a synchronization operation if it … two operations form a race with each other … are no other operations between them. … [p. 75] [The programmer labels operations as synchronization or data.] The programmer can provide accurate information …   Google-1   Google-2

Copyright clearance needed for quotation.


Related Topics up

Topic: optimistic update for concurrency control (35 items)
Topic: race conditions (30 items)
Topic: code optimization by advice and statistics (8 items)
Topic: man-machine symbiosis (46 items)

Copyright © 2002-2008 by C. Bradford Barber. All rights reserved.
Thesa is a trademark of C. Bradford Barber.